### Step 4 — Blue-green cutover for TallyGrind billing worker

Verify green pool is healthy. Flip the router weight to 100% green. Watch invoice throughput for ten minutes; if error rate exceeds 1%, revert to blue immediately. Do not drain blue until finance sign-off. Support: all customer-visible retries are automatic, no manual action needed. The green pool must run with these values.

settings of fafog-haduf:
ZORIX_PIN=4648
ZORIX_METRICS_HOST=metrics.zorix.paliqsys.corp
ZORIX_LOG_LEVEL=info
ZORIX_TENANT=druix

Ticket: Staging env misconfigured for Siftgate bloom filter

The bloom layer in front of the Pellet KV store is rejecting all lookups in staging because the env file was copied from the dev template without credentials. False-positive tuning values are fine; only the auth line is missing. To unblock the weekly demo, the Pellet admission secret must be set on the following line.

env line for yaguf-fajop: LEDGER_TOKEN13=fb08984397349

## Idempotency Keys for Payment Retries (Lumopay)

Every retry of a charge request must reuse the original idempotency key; generating a new key on retry can produce duplicate charges. Keys are scoped per merchant and expire after 48 hours. Reviewers should verify keys are derived server-side, never from client input. The full key-generation specification and threat model are maintained on the internal page.

dashboard of kaguf-tawip = https://vault.merlaqsys.test/issue

## Onboarding: Fareweight Rules Engine

Fareweight computes shipping fees from stacked rule sets. Rules are versioned; never edit a live version. Deploys go through the staging evaluator first. Read the rule DSL guide before touching anything.

Rule definitions live in the pricing database — connect to it with the connection string below.

primary connection of yagep-bajop = postgresql://druiel_svc:gW@db-3860.sivrelworks.example:5432/brieth